Tampa tight end coming to Dallas
By the Associated Press
(August 28, 1996)
IRVING (AP) - Tyji Armstrong, a four-year veteran tight end who
was cut Sunday by Tampa Bay, has agreed to terms with the Dallas
Cowboys to fill the final spot on their roster.
The Cowboys have only one healthy tight end, Derek Ware, on their
roster for the season opener on Sept. 2 in Chicago. Jay Novacek
has a bad back, Eric Bjornson is bothered by a hamstring pull
and Kendall Watkins was lost for the season with a knee injury.
Armstrong, expected to settle for the NFL minimum of $275,000
and a one-year contract, has a reputation of being a good run
blocker. He was a cap casualty in Tampa Bay, where he would have
made $800,000 this season.
